In a letter to Finance Minister Arun Jaitley, differently abled people have sought higher income tax exemption in this year’s Union Budget, especially with rising inflation.

“Income tax exemption under Section 80U for people with disabilities (with disability up to 80 per cent), has been stagnant at Rs 50,000 for many years. Similarly, for people with severe disability (with disability more than 80 per cent) it is Rs 1,00,000,” said the letter by Javed Abidi, Honorary Direcrtor, National Centre for Promotion of Employment for Disabled People (NCPEDP).

It suggested that for disability of 40- 80 per cent, exemption may be increased to Rs 1,00,000 and for those with disability above 80 per cent, the exemption may be increased to Rs 1,50,000.

Such a move will greatly benefit the disabled population of the country as the cost of living for persons with disabilities is additionally high because of the assistive devices they require, said Abidi.
